Laser-Cut Heat Transfer Vinyl Material Safety Guide: Avoiding Toxic Risks from Source Control
As specialists in laser heat transfer vinyl cutting systems, we present evidence-based material selection strategies to mitigate toxic emissions:
Absolutely Prohibited Materials
PVC-based substrates: Decompose under laser heat to release hydrochloric acid (HCl) gas (>5ppm exceeds OSHA limits, causing respiratory burns).
Metal composite coatings: Nano-scale metal oxide particles from aluminum/PET films penetrate alveoli into bloodstream.
Solvent-based ink layers: Benzopyrene (Group 1 carcinogen) forms when cutting benzene-containing coatings.

Laser-Cut Vinyl Operation Guide & Advanced Techniques
■ Beginner Recommendations
Start with small vinyl decals to master fundamentals before advancing to complex projects (e.g., custom T-shirt designs).
■ Core Techniques
Parameter Calibration:
Test settings on scrap materials from the same batch.
Recalibrate power/speed for new material batches.
Intricate Pattern Handling:
Use layered cutting: 2-3 low-power passes with full cooling between cycles to prevent warping.
Post-Processing Protocol:
Remove residues within 30 minutes for clean edges.
Use specialized tools for delicate areas.
■ Advanced Notes
Storage: Store unopened rolls vertically; seal opened materials in moisture-proof bags.
Maintenance: Clean laser lenses and inspect exhaust systems every 8 hours.
